Basement drywall board types used in Forest Heights homes in Edmonton

Standard drywall — interior basement walls in Forest Heights

Standard 1/2” drywall is correct for interior partition walls inside an Forest Heights basement that have no moisture exposure — the walls separating a home office from a bedroom, partition walls in a recreation room or home theatre. In Forest Heights basements it saves handling effort while finishing exactly like the main floors. Most interior basement partition walls in Forest Heights homes use standard board.

Moisture-resistant, soundproof and fire-rated — where the spec matters in Forest Heights

Exterior foundation walls in Forest Heights homes need moisture-resistant board even with a vapour barrier. For bathrooms and laundry in Forest Heights, moisture-resistant board goes on every wall. Code puts 5/8” Type X fire-rated board on every Forest Heights suite ceiling. The Forest Heights suite-to-main party wall is where STC soundproof board earns its cost — you can hear the difference. What type of drywall do you use for exterior basement walls in Edmonton?
Moisture-resistant (green board or purple board) on all walls against the exterior foundation and around plumbing and laundry. For Forest Heights interior partitions clear of moisture, standard 1/2” drywall is the right product. For legal suites, 5/8” Type X fire-rated on the ceiling and soundproof board on party walls. We specify before we start.
